OverviewUter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E), also known as Uterine Artery Embolization (UAE), is a minimally invasive, non-surgical procedure used to treat uterine fibroids. Uterine fibroids are non-cancerous growths that develop in the muscular wall of the uterus. These fibroids can cause a range of symptoms, such as heavy menstrual bleeding, pelvic pain, and pressure on nearby organs. UFE works by blocking the blood flow to the fibroids, causing them to shrink and alleviate the associated symptoms. Although most fibroids do not cause noticeable symptoms, some can grow larger, causing pain, discomfort, and other health issues.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E) is a relatively newer technique that has gained popularity as a less invasive alternative to traditional surgical methods for treating uterine fibroids. During the UFE procedure, a radiologist uses specialized imaging techniques to guide tiny particles (embolic agents) into the blood vessels that supply blood to the fibroids. These particles block the blood flow to the fibroids, causing them to shrink over time.Symptoms of Uterine Fibroids: The symptoms of uterine fibroids can vary depending on the size, number, and location of the fibroids. Some common symptoms include:Heavy Menstrual Bleeding: Experiencing prolonged and heavy menstrual periods is a common symptom of uterine fibroids.Pelvic Pain: Fibroids can cause chronic pelvic pain and discomfort.Pressure on Nearby Organs: Large fibroids may put pressure on the bladder or rectum, leading to frequent urination or constipation.Abdominal Enlargement: Some women with uterine fibroids may notice a mild bulge or enlargement in their lower abdomen.Anemia: Excessive bleeding from uterine fibroids can lead to iron-deficiency anemia.Causes of Uterine FibroidsThe exact cause of uterine fibroids is not fully understood. However, various factors may contribute to their development, including:Hormones: Estrogen and progesterone hormones play a role in the growth and development of uterine fibroids.Genetic Predisposition: A family history of uterine fibroids may increase the risk of developing them.Age: Uterine fibroids are more common during the reproductive years and tend to shrink after menopause when hormone levels decrease.Race: Certain ethnic groups, particularly African-American women, have a higher risk of developing uterine fibroids.Treatment: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E):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E) is a minimally invasive procedure performed by an interventional radiologist. The steps involved in UFE treatment are as follows:Pre-procedure Evaluation: The patient undergoes a thorough evaluation, including a medical history review, physical examination, and imaging studies, such as ultrasound or MRI, to assess the size and location of the fibroids.Anesthesia: UFE is typically performed under conscious sedation, where the patient is awake but relaxed, or under general anesthesia, depending on the individual's preference and medical condition.Catheter Placement: The interventional radiologist inserts a thin, flexible catheter into the femoral artery through a small incision in the groin.Embolization: Tiny embolic agents are injected through the catheter into the blood vessels that supply blood to the fibroids, blocking their blood flow and causing them to shrink.Recovery: After the procedure, the patient is monitored for a few hours and may be discharged the same day or the following day, depending on the recovery progress.Benefits of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E):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E) offers several benefits compared to traditional surgical approaches:Minimally Invasive: UFE is a less invasive procedure than traditional surgery, resulting in smaller incisions, reduced scarring, and quicker recovery.Preserves Uterus: Unlike surgical options like hysterectomy (removal of the uterus), UFE preserves the uterus, allowing women to retain their fertility and hormonal balance.Effective Symptom Relief: UFE has been shown to provide significant relief from uterine fibroid symptoms, such as heavy menstrual bleeding and pelvic pain.Shorter Recovery Time: Patients typically experience a shorter recovery period after UFE compared to surgical interventions.Cost of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E) in India: The cost of Uter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E) in India can vary depending on factors such as the hospital or medical facility, the expertise of the interventional radiologist, the size and number of fibroids, and the patient's overall health. On average, the cost of UFE in India ranges from ?1,50,000 to ?4,00,000 or more.ConclusionUterine Fibroid Embolization (UFE) is a minimally invasive, non-surgical procedure used to treat uterine fibroids by blocking their blood supply, leading to their shrinkage and symptom relief. UFE offers several benefits, such as a shorter recovery time, preservation of the uterus, and effective symptom relief. As a less invasive alternative to traditional surgical interventions, UFE has become a popular choice for women seeking to manage uterine fibroids and improve their quality of life. Patients considering UFE should undergo a thorough evaluation, discuss the potential risks and benefits with their healthcare team, and choose a reputable medical facility with experienced interventional radiologists to ensure the best possible outcome.
